Overview
South Korean physical AI company developing robotic intelligence software and hardware for factory automation. Founded in 2024, CarbonSix combines AI-powered imitation learning with precision robotic manipulators to automate variable, labor-intensive manufacturing tasks. Its SigmaKit toolkit enables robots to learn directly from human demonstrations, eliminating traditional programming requirements. The company's products are already deployed in commercial manufacturing environments, using a proprietary data flywheel that continuously improves AI models from real-world factory operations. CEO Tae-yeon Terry Moon previously co-founded SUALAB, an industrial AI vision company acquired by Cognex.
